Off-topic from your excellent tent, I notice in your last photo the rudder appears to have a stainless steel re-enforcement  strip on the leading edge and foot.  This seems a good idea. Was it fitted as standard by Swallowboats or did you specify it? 

Has anyone else fitted a protective strip retrospectively? And perhaps used plastic/rubber or other more resilient or sacrificial material to protect the rudder?

I have the same stainless steel protection strips on my rudder and CB. I asked Matt to fit them after our first season's sailing when I decided they were at risk from damage. They do a very good job and should be on the options list if not already there. Looks like some standard domed SS strip that has been used and screwed on.
